COVID-19 Information

The City of Kinston is supporting the State of North Carolina and Lenoir County Health Department in protecting the health and safety of our community during the COVID-19 pandemic. This page is a collection of information from the state, county, and city sharing COVID updates and information about vaccinations.

All residents 18 and older are eligible for the vaccine in North Carolina. You have a spot, take your shot!

Vaccination and Testing Information

Use the North Carolina Vaccine Location Finder to find a location best for you! Lenoir County Transit is offering free rides to anyone going to be vaccinated. Call 252-523-4171 before 1pm, at least one business day in advance to reserve your spot!

Many more locations are available throughout Lenoir County - Go to MySpot.nc.gov to find the best location for you!
